Weather in March

March, the first month of the autumn in Ngerengere, is still a warm month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 28.9°C (84°F) and an average low of 20.3°C (68.5°F).

Temperature

Entering March, the average high-temperature is recorded at a still moderately hot 28.9°C (84°F), exhibiting a minimal shift from February's 29.8°C (85.6°F). Ngerengere, during the month of March, experiences an average low-temperature of 20.3°C (68.5°F).

Heat index

The average heat index in March is computed to be a very hot 35°C (95°F). Greater safety measures are needed, risk of heat exhaustion and heat cramps is high. Continuous activity might trigger heatstroke.
The metrics for the heat index are tailored for both shady environments and light winds. With exposure to direct sunlight, the heat index may be increased by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'apparent temperature', provides an understanding of perceived warmth by combining temperature and relative humidity. This effect tends to be personal, with the weather perception differing among individuals due to variations in body mass, height, and exertion. You should know that direct sun exposure can heighten weather effects, potentially elevating the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are essentially critical for children. Young individuals are typically more threatened than adults due to their reduced perspiration. Also, the larger skin surface proportionate to their small bodies and the increased heat from their activities magnify their risk.
Humans rely on perspiration as a cooling mechanism, wherein the evaporating sweat counteracts excessive warmth. A surge in relative humidity can disrupt the body's normal cooling function by slowing evaporation, hence reducing the rate at which the body cools and intensifying the perception of heat. When the heat gained surpasses the body's cooling capacity, temperatures rise, signaling potential health concerns.

Humidity

In March, the average relative humidity is 84%.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is March, when the rain falls for 29.3 days and typically aggregates up to 256mm (10.08") of precipitation.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day is 12h and 8min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:32 and sunset at 18:46. On the last day of March, sunrise is at 06:30 and sunset at 18:32 EAT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in March is 7.9h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are January through March, May through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
